Oracle启动ASM:从零开始(oracle启动asm)

最近,Holden开始使用Oracle的ASM,他使用我们下面提供的步骤在Oracle环境中启动ASM。

步骤1:安装ASM组件

Oracle的ASM(自动存储管理器)是一个审查存储器中的文件和数据库对象的功能,可用于在Oracle数据库环境中管理卷组和存储空间。要安装ASM组件,必须先安装ASM实例,然后安装ASM组件。Oracle提供了标准的安装(DBCA)和高级安装(RUNINSTALLER)向导用于安装ASM实例。安装ASM组件前,也可以使用ASMCMD实用程序检查服务器的存储架构。

步骤2:在ASM实例上创建磁盘组

安装完ASM组件后,用户可以通过SQL*Plus和SYS AS SYSDBA权限创建磁盘组并授权。在ASM实例单实例上,可以通过以下SQL代码创建磁盘组:

SQL:CREATE DISKGROUP test REPLACE;

关联DISKGROUP名称,完成磁盘组创建后,可以使用以下指令扩展磁盘组:

SQL:ALTER DISKGROUP test ADD DISK ‘…’;

步骤3:在ASM环境中启动实例

完成上述步骤后,用户可以使用SRVCTL进程管理工具启动ASM实例,该工具可在服务器的多个实例之间共享资源。我们可使用以下命令来启动ASM实例:

SRVCTL:srvctl start instance -n -i

另外,我们可以通过以下命令查看ASM实例的运行情况:

SRVCTL:srvctl status instance -n -i

正常情况下,ASM实例将以正常状态运行。

步骤4:测试ASM

到目前为止,我们已在Oracle环境中完成了ASM的启动,我们可以使用ASMCMD工具来测试ASM实例,用来查看ASM实例的参数和信息,可以使用以下命令查看ASM实例:

ASMCMD:asmcmd lsdg

此命令将打印出可用的磁盘组及相关信息。如果运行此命令时不出现任何错误,则说明ASM启动成功。

通过上述步骤,Holden完成了在Oracle环境中启动ASM的过程。ASM可以与Oracle数据库一起运行,提供可靠的存储设施,有效地管理存储资源,以及更高级别的性能。


数据运维技术 » Oracle启动ASM:从零开始(oracle启动asm)